Bureau of Refugees Freedmen & A Lands
Office Supt Sixth Dist Va
Winchester Va April 6th 1866

Col. O. Brown, Asst Commr
Richmond Va
Colonel
In reference to the operations of Circular No 10" from your Head Quarters I have the honor to report I have made every effort to bring it to the knowledge of every magistrate in this district excepting the counties of Berkeley and Jefferson which are in West Virginia, but that sufficient time has not elapsed since March 19th the date of its [[inception?]] by me to afford any data on which to base a report of this manner in which this order is carried out.

The case of Dooley is stated in the report of Bureau affairs in Sub Dist "D" would indicate that the civil authorities are not active in their exertions to [[strikethrough]] punish [[/strikethrough]] enforce the law against white murderers of freedmen.
I am Colonel
Very Respectfully
Your Obedient Servt
W. Stover How
Bt Maj AQM & Supt
